Artisan Info: Jewelry accessories are one of the greatest artistic expressions of humankind. They can symbolize cultures and specific epochs, and Brazilian jewelry is linked both to European styles and indigenous themes. Minas Gerais is a Brazilian state known since colonial times for its abundance of gold and precious stones, especially in its riverbeds and subsoil. A great part of the economic and social development of the region is owed to its mineral richness. Its name in Portuguese translates literally as "General Mines." It is in the cities of Minas Gerais where some of Brazil's first notable artists flourished, such as sculptors and painters of Baroque churches. Despite the great potential of the region, goldsmith and stonework were prohibited during colonial times, and artists worked clandestinely up until the mid-nineteenth century.
